National Front marching with placards, London; 1968
Sequence of shots showing National Front marching through London. Placards reading 'white power', 'don't knock Enoch', 'stop immigration now', 'jobs and housing - Britons first'; 1968 (BBC News, 343-68-02 - 08/12/1968 - AEXZ288W)
